The compound formed between sodium (Na) and oxygen (O) is sodium oxide (Na2O). The formula for sodium oxide is Na2O.
Sodium oxide, Na2O, is the ionic compound formed between sodium (Na) and oxygen (O). In this compound, sodium donates one electron to oxygen, resulting in the formation of Na+ and O2- ions held together by ionic bonds.
